Southern Connecticut State University

Southern Connecticut State University (SCSU) needed a solution to fill gaps between research administration software and supplementary paper processes. To automate manual processes, SCSU used Kuali Build. Administrators estimate Kuali Build saves $675,000 by reallocating staff time from simple paper processing to actual information management.

Murray State University

Murray State University needed a comprehensive solution to modernize their curriculum management process. The institution chose Kuali Curriculum & Catalog Management and has since received full institutional buy-in, improved data tracking, streamlined processes, and saved hundreds of hours for high-value employees. In addition, Murray State benefited from the cloud-based platform when admin and faculty were required to work from home.
